5.2.1.2 Telephony / Phonebook

Multiple telephone numbers can be entered in the phonebook.
These can be used as input elsewhere, for example when setting up 'Schedules'.
A 'Profile' can be associated with each 'Phonebook entry'.
A 'Profile' is a set of settings. This allows definition of an individual settings profile for each
telephone number.
Phonebook:
The green '+' creates a new line.
The '>>' behind a line opens the details for this line.
The red X behind a line deletes the line from the list.
